早教吧作业答案频道 -->其他-->
JAVA测试题目求大神帮我忙非常感谢创建一个Compu类,要求:(1)具有二个带参数的构造方法:第一个构造方法接受传递过来的两个整数;第二个构造方法接受传递过来的一个整数。(2)
题目详情
JAVA 测试题目 求大神帮我忙 非常感谢
创建一个Compu类,要求:
(1)具有二个带参数的构造方法:第一个构造方法接受传递过来的两个整数;第二个构造方法接受传递过来的一个整数。
(2)具有二个方法:一个方法能实现对两个整数进行加减乘除四则运算;第二个方法能实现求一个整数的平方。
(3)当进行除法运算时,若除数为0,必须捕获产生的ArithmeticException类对象,并提示除数为0的错误。
(4)编写测试类CompuTest进行测试,创建二个Compu类对象,分别调用求两个整数四则运算的方法和求一个整数平方的方法并输出结果。
创建一个Compu类,要求:
(1)具有二个带参数的构造方法:第一个构造方法接受传递过来的两个整数;第二个构造方法接受传递过来的一个整数。
(2)具有二个方法:一个方法能实现对两个整数进行加减乘除四则运算;第二个方法能实现求一个整数的平方。
(3)当进行除法运算时,若除数为0,必须捕获产生的ArithmeticException类对象,并提示除数为0的错误。
(4)编写测试类CompuTest进行测试,创建二个Compu类对象,分别调用求两个整数四则运算的方法和求一个整数平方的方法并输出结果。
▼优质解答
答案和解析
给你个例子,手写的,没测试
1.
public Compu(int a, int b)
public Compu(int a)
2.假设你要求出所有四则运算的值
int[] calulate(int a, int b) {
int[] result = new int[4];
result[0] = a+b;
result[1] = a-b;
result[2] = a*b;
try {
result[3] = a/b;
} catch (ArithmeticException e) {
if (b == 0) System.err.println("除数为0");
else e.printStackTrace();
}
return result;
}
double sqrt(int a) {
return Math.sqrt(Double.parseDouble(String.valueOf(a)));
}
看了 JAVA测试题目求大神帮我忙...的网友还看了以下:
下列行为中属于行政指导的是A国立大学的辅导员给学生上就业指导课B乡政府下乡搞计划生育宣传C司法局主 2020-05-17 …
公园里正在进行庆“六一”节目汇演,小朋友的欢呼声传遍整个公园,这反映了声音(选填“响度”或“音调”) 2020-11-06 …
求救高一地理的信风带无法理解.什么向左便向右便.rt比如赤道底气压带上的暖气流在高空由南风逐渐右偏成 2020-11-24 …
如图所示,一半径r=0.2m的14光滑圆弧形槽底端B与水平传带相接,传送带的运行速度为v0=4m/s 2020-11-26 …
如图所示,一半径r=0.2m的14光滑圆弧形槽底端B与水平传带相接,传送带的运行速度为v0=4m/s 2020-11-26 …
如图所示是用来测电动机输出功率的传统方法.在电动机皮带轮外套上一段摩擦带,带的一端通过橡皮筋固定在天 2020-12-10 …
2008年,清明节等三个传统节假日敲开了国家法定节日的大门。4月4日是清明节,是国务院规定新增的第一 2020-12-13 …
国家调整法定节假日草案支持率法定节假日总天数由10天增加到11天88%调整“五一”并增加三个传统节日 2020-12-14 …
在许多民俗学者建议下,自2008年起,国家调整法定假日,增加清明、端午、中秋等传统节日为法定假日。国 2020-12-14 …
下列有关克隆的叙述错误的是()A.二倍体细胞的传代培养次数通常是有限的B.克隆培养法培养过程中多数细 2021-01-07 …